    Ask the Community - Sharetea

    What are your decaffeinated drinks?

    Our decaffeinated drinks are as follow: Strawberry ice blended Mango ice blended… 

    Do you offer e-cards/gift cards?

    Yea we do off gift vouchers.

    Are the ice blended drinks made with real fruit?

    Hi Mike, the fruity ice blended, we do use fruit jam which is made with real fruit. Please let us know if you have any other questions. Thanks

    Do you use cane sugar or high fructose corn syrup?

    Hi there, we use corn syrup fructose. Thank you

    Are there any dairy alternatives like soy or almond milk?

    Hey! They just came out with milk alternatives the other day for their fresh milk series! The only alternative I know of is their unsweetened almond milk :) Hope that helps

    Do they take orders over the phone or online?

    We are working on an online ordering platform. Once that is up and running, we will post on our social media outlets. Tor now if you can kindly stop by our store to place your order. We do have safety measures in place. Thank you for asking.
